Béatrice Eymin
About
Béatrice Eymin has authored 58 papers that have received a total of 2.7k indexed citations.
This includes 52 papers in Molecular Biology, 26 papers in Oncology and 11 papers in Cancer Research. The topics of these papers are Cancer-related Molecular Pathways (18 papers), RNA modifications and cancer (17 papers) and RNA Research and Splicing (12 papers). Béatrice Eymin is often cited by papers focused on Cancer-related Molecular Pathways (18 papers), RNA modifications and cancer (17 papers) and RNA Research and Splicing (12 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in France, United States and China. Béatrice Eymin's co-authors include Sylvie Gazzéri, Élisabeth Brambilla, Christian Brambilla, Éric Solary and Jean‐Luc Coll and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, The EMBO Journal and Blood.
